-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于微信端的智能家居监控系统的设计与实现
摘要:针对科技的迅速发展、人民生活质量的提高、智能家居产业的迅速发展,对智能家居控制系统进行分析和研究,提出一种低成本、易扩展,适用于家庭应用的家居控制系统。设计出一种基于树莓派的智能家居控制系统。利用树莓派、Cortex-M0模块、ZigBee模块、GPS和GPRS模块来实现家居的控制。该系统最终实现了微信控制,移动通信,北斗定位和树莓派协同工作的智能家居多网系统。结果表明:该系统硬件设备简单、成本较低、系统可靠、易于扩展。
关键词:智能家居;树莓派;Linux;定位;传感器
中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2016)31-0208-03
智能家居是在传统住宅的基础上实现家电信息数字化、网络化,设备自动化,并实现了管理、系统、结构的一体化,从而构建了新型的舒适、便利、高效、安全、环保的家居环境。利用先进的计算机技术、网络通讯技术、综合布线技术,将与家居生活有关的各种子系统,有机地结合在一起,通过统筹管理,实现“以人为本”的全新家居生活体验。
我国的智能家居行业兴起于20世纪90年代后期,以上海、广州、深圳等一线城市为典型并逐渐向二三线城市发展。随着科技的进步,网络化进程的加速,信息化建设也得到了广泛的普及。目前我国家庭拥有Internet入网设备的比例达到70%,而一线城市有50%的住宅将实现智能化。国家设立信息网络技术体系研究及产品开发重点专项项目以及家庭信息网络技术委员会等措施也将加速我国的家居智能化的进程。
本系统进行了以下的创新,它是一种基于树莓派的智能家居多网系统。通过在树莓派中搭建Linux操作系统,并运行智能家居控制程序,形成主控系统,实现家居智能化管理,同时为了达到智能控制功能,我们还设计了定位系统、传感器系统两大系统来辅助主控系统。定位系统是用来实时收集家居主人位置信息,主要跟随家居主人随身移动,使得主控系统可以根据家居主人是否在家中作出智能控制。传感器系统则用来接收和发送家居信息。
1 系统的主要功能和总体结构设计
我们设计了一个在搭载着Linux系统的树莓派上建立一个智能家居主控系统,同时协调控制基于Cortex-M0的传感器子系统和定位子系统,以此建立一个家居智能化系统,系统通信使用ZigBee和3G通信的方式,系统控制则通过微信的方法?M行控制。
主控系统可以实现远程监控功能,同时建立微信端提供用户交互界面,使得用户可以给传感器系统发送控制命令和接收传感器所采集到的数据,让家居主人可通过微信访问来查询、控制智能设备。
传感器系统分为控制端和采集端,控制端可接收来自主控系统的控制命令,实现智能设备的控制,在我们的设计中可控制小灯的开关和风扇的开关,采集端用来采集各传感器数据,例如温度数据、湿度数据等,最终显示到主控系统中的微信页面上。
定位系统主要提供家居主人的实时位置信息,并通过Internet传送到阿里云服务器端,最终主控系统会根据家居主人的位置信息来实现一些自动化的控制,在我们的设计中家居主人的位置一旦出现在家半径500米内,即可触发传感器系统中的报警器。
2 系统的硬件设计
硬件设计介绍了本系统中主控系统、传感器系统、定位系统的硬件模块选择以及硬件连接。下文在介绍时将先给出三大系统的总体硬件设计,然后分别介绍所选用的硬件模块
2.1 主控系统硬件设计
主控模块采用树莓派作为主控系统,外围协调一个USB摄像头作为监控,同时接上ZigBee与传感器模块进行控制通信。Raspberry Pi作为主控系统有以下的优点:1.设计为树莓派选择搭载Raspbian系统,它相对于小巧的arch Linux ARM系统更加完善,因此其镜像文件体积也比较大。它本身自带ssh,免去了复杂的ssh移植过程,而且可以运行C、C++、JAVA和Python等程序,为本系统接下来所编写的代码提供便捷的运行环境;2.设计选用的是ARM+Linux+Internet的模式,对此树莓派可以出色地实现这些功能,硬件的简化又恰好诠释隐蔽的特点;3 .软硬件可裁剪的嵌入式系统。我们选用中兴微zc301USB的Linux免驱摄像头,通过树莓派的USB 2.0接口与USB摄像头模块相连,即可实现USB摄像头与控制平台的数据连接和交换。USB摄像头主要用来采集数据图像,存储至树莓派中,并对数据帧中的数据进行压缩解码,我们还选用了ZigBee芯片为TI CC2530F256,将此芯片通过USB串口与树莓派进行连接,即可通过树莓派编程驱动ZigBee模块工作,与传感器系统中的ZigBee模块进行通信,以达到主控系统控制传感器系统工作的目的。
2.2 传感器系统硬件设计
您可能关注的文档
最近下载
- 施工企业现场质量管理制度及奖惩办法.pdf VIP
- 传感器原理及应用 教案.pdf VIP
- 砂石料供应、运输、售后服务方案14627.pdf VIP
- 传承雷锋精神争做时代新人--主题班会课件.pptx VIP
- 气管切开非机械通气患者气道管理考试题及答案.doc
- 横河flxa21两线制电导率变送器快速启动手册.pdf VIP
- 图集规范-天津图集-12J5-1图集(2012版)平屋面 DBJT29-18-2013.pdf VIP
- 第2课+丰富多彩的中华传统体育+课件 2025-2026学年人教版(2024)初中体育与健康八年级全一册.pptx VIP
- 第12课 闭环控制助稳定 教案 义务教育人教版信息科技六年级全一册.pdf VIP
- 生命教育PPT模板.pptx VIP
文档评论(0)